Handover: bulk edits in the Quillgate admin table. Rentaro finished the multi-select work last sprint; up to 500 rows can now be edited in one batch. Validation runs per-row, so partial failures return a summary instead of rolling back everything. Known gap: the audit log only records the batch ID, not individual field changes — Priya is picking that up next. Rate limits are unchanged. Full notes, edge cases, and the rollback procedure are on the internal page below.

operations page: https://jenkins.zemvarcloud.local/job/merge_requests/repo/build/73930b4b30f0a8ed

Handover: SquatWatch scanner

Taking over from Priya's old setup. SquatWatch polls the Fernmark registry mirror every 20 minutes and flags packages with names within edit distance 2 of our internal list. Alerts go to the triage queue; don't mute them, even if noisy. Deploys are manual for now — script in the repo root. Everything it needs at runtime is set via the block below.

deployment values, kajep-kageg:
[praix]
host = praix.paliqcorp.corp
user = praix_svc
database = praix_prod

Ticket BLD-2291: Migrate Marrowset build to hermetic toolchain.

Scope: replace host-installed compilers with pinned toolchain images, drop network fetches during compile, vendor remaining deps. New team members: do not merge build-file changes until this lands; partial migration breaks caching. Blocked on final sign-off. Sign-off authority for this migration is held by the person below.

approver of yawig-yajef = Briius Jorix

### Alert: greenhouse-7 sensor drift

Heads up for the sync — the Verdacre controller in greenhouse 7 keeps flagging humidity drift on the north-bay sensors. Readings wander ~4% over 12 hours, then snap back after recalibration. Probably the cheap probes from the last batch, not firmware. Alert fires roughly twice a week now. If you want raw drift logs, ask the sensor team.

alerts address for bafog-tawep: ulavan_sorwyn_fraax@kelviworks.local